Khmelnytskyi Eparchy organizes meeting with surgeon-priest Valikhnovskyi

Meeting of Orthodox youth with UOC Archpriest Rostyslav Valikhnovskyi. Photo: Press Service of the Khmelnytskyi Eparchy of the UOC

On February 15, 2026, on the Feast of the Meeting of the Lord, a meeting of Orthodox youth with UOC Archpriest Rostyslav Valikhnovskyi took place in Khmelnytskyi. This was reported by the press service of the Khmelnytskyi Eparchy of the UOC.

The event was held at the Church of the Nativity of the Most Holy Theotokos. The guest of the meeting was an Honored Doctor of Ukraine, a surgeon, and a cleric of the Holy Protection Monastery in Kyiv, Archpriest Rostyslav Valikhnovskyi.

Metropolitan Victor of Khmelnytskyi and Starokostiantyniv addressed the participants with a welcoming word and introduced the invited guest. The main theme of the priest’s talk was how to remain faithful to Christian principles in the conditions of war. After the talk, participants were able to ask questions and speak in an open format.

At the conclusion of the meeting, the youth coordinator, Archimandrite Paisiy (Kulish), thanked Metropolitan Victor and Archpriest Rostyslav for a substantive conversation. To commemorate the event, Bishop Victor presented the guest with an icon of the Protection of the Most Holy Theotokos.
